Toilet paper wedding dress wins Ripley’s Believe it or Not

Nearly every girls dream is to get married in the perfect wedding dress but what if you could get married in toilet roll, well maybe not that nasty when you look at the toilet paper wedding dress that has just won the Ripley’s Believe it or Not competition. The event saw six majestic wedding gowns that were made from things unlike an ordinary dress; these included packing tape, glue and toilet paper.
The event was held at in Times Square, New York and the First-place winner was Katrina Chalifoux, her wedding dress won the Cheap and Chic Toilet Paper Wedding Dress Contest. This saw her take a prize of $1,000 and amazingly the dress did look like it was made from fabric, although it was made from seven rolls of plain old toilet paper.
The top three dresses will be displayed around the world over the next year at different Ripley locations. People who saw the dresses could not believe that the paper from a bathroom made such a stunning dress, this shows those that are on a budget that a dress can be made on the cheap and still look amazing.
While the dress looks amazing, can you imagine at a real wedding getting one little pull or rip, the dress would be history and if it rained…imagine that. The second place went to Terro Glover of Marlin, Texas and Ann Lee, of Honolulu, Hawaii, held the third place.
